Job Description and Duties

Applicants at the Staff Services Analyst and Associate Governmental Program Analyst (SSA/AGPA) level will be considered. Under the direction of the Staff Services Manager I, the incumbent will perform the following duties:

Compose, coordinate, and edit the analysis of complex state and federal waste management and recycling legislation. This is expected to be accomplished through continuous program review, statistical analysis, and investigation or relevant research. The analyst will also develop amendment language to legislation; write letters to legislators to communicate CalRecycle’s position on bills; identify and assess stakeholders, fiscal impacts, health and safety issues, and programmatic impacts of legislation; routinely consult with and/or respond to inquiries from legislative offices, interest groups, other state agencies, and the public regarding waste management and recycling policy; continuously and independently research issues related to state and federal legislation, fiscal and budget issues, and general waste management and recycling policy issues; draft testimony and prepare information for the Deputy Director for Legislation to present at legislative committee hearings or other private or public engagements; and attend meetings on legislation on behalf of CalRecycle with legislative staff, stakeholders, and other interest groups.
